One of many minimum-acknowledged points about Georgian wine is that Ga is taken into account the birthplace of wine. Archaeological proof indicates that wine generation in Ga dates back again in excess of 8,000 a long time, making it the oldest identified wine-generating region on the planet. This ancient custom has ongoing by way of millennia, passing down from era to generation, using methods that keep on being mainly unchanged. The winemaking tactics utilized in Ga are contrary to All those located elsewhere, which has become the prime tricks that wine enthusiasts are setting up to find.

The use of qvevri, significant clay vessels buried underground, is Among the most distinctive options of Georgian winemaking. This historical technique of fermenting wine in these vessels allows for a natural, organic and natural method that offers the wine its special characteristics. The qvevri strategy is amongst the most vital revelations about Georgian wine that A lot of people outside the house the region are unfamiliar with. It offers a singular taste profile that sets Georgian wine aside from additional conventional winemaking techniques. These massive, egg-formed clay jars are integral to the manufacture of both equally pink and white wines inside the place, providing organic insulation and letting for a lengthy, slow fermentation procedure.

One more intriguing actuality about Georgian wine is the sheer diversity of indigenous grape varieties grown within the region. Although a lot of wine areas world wide deal with a few select grape kinds, Georgia offers around five hundred indigenous kinds. Many of the most very well-regarded Georgian wines are constructed from grapes for instance Saperavi, and that is a purple grape known for creating deep, strong wines, and Rkatsiteli, a white grape that results in refreshing, crisp wines. These grape kinds supply flavors and aromas which are rarely located in other areas of the entire world, creating them a perfectly-retained key among wine fans.

The culture of winemaking in Ga is not just concerning the creation of wine but in addition about its consumption. Wine is usually a central Component of Georgian tradition, with rituals and traditions tied to its pleasure. The most effective techniques to understand Georgian wine will be to expertise it firsthand through the lens of Georgian hospitality. Supra, the standard Georgian feast, is a wonderful way to learn more with regards to the part wine performs in Georgian Modern society. At a supra, wine flows freely, and attendees participate in quite a few toasts led by the tamada, or toastmaster, who guides the evening’s festivities. This personalized reveals an excellent deal about Georgian wine, mainly because it shows how deeply it truly is intertwined with Georgian society and social practices.

Together with the cultural importance of wine in Ga, the state’s various geography contributes on the distinctiveness of its wine. The vineyards are distribute throughout a variety of various climates and altitudes, in the lush, fertile valleys for the mountainous areas. This wide variety in terrain has authorized for the cultivation of grapes with diverse flavor profiles. The terroir in regions like Kakheti, Imereti, and Racha contributes towards the special tastes and attributes of Georgian wines. Kakheti, specifically, is among A very powerful wine areas, generally thought of the guts of Georgian wine generation.
